How to Fix Qualcomm IMEI Null or Network Issues via ADB Mode

If your Qualcomm-powered smartphone is showing IMEI Null, Unknown Baseband, or No Network / No Signal issues, you are in the right place. This problem usually occurs after flashing a wrong custom ROM, an interrupted system update, or a corrupted EFS partition.

In this guide, we will walk you through how to use the HUIYE Qualcomm Write IMEI Repair Tool via ADB Mode to restore your original IMEI and fix network issues.

Important Requirements (Prerequisites) Before starting the process, make sure you have the following ready. A Windows PC or Laptop.

An Original USB Cable to connect your phone to the PC. Your phone’s Original IMEI Numbers (Can be found on the phone’s retail box or purchase bill).

Step-by-Step Guide: Qualcomm IMEI Repair via ADB Follow these steps carefully to fix your device's IMEI and restore cellular network.

Step 1: Enable USB Debugging (ADB Mode) Go to your smartphone's Settings > About Phone.Tap on the Build Number 7 times continuously until you see the message You are now a developer. Go back to the main Settings menu, open Developer Options, and turn ON USB Debugging.

Step 2: Install ADB Drivers & Connect Phone Extract and install the ADB Drivers Version 1.4.3 on your Windows PC. Connect your smartphone to the PC using the USB cable. Look at your phone screen; if an Allow USB Debugging? prompt appears, check Always allow and tap OK.

Step 3: Launch the Qualcomm Write IMEI Tool Extract the downloaded Qualcomm Write IMEI Repair Tool and run the executable file. The user interface will open (as shown in the screenshot above). Ensure that your device is correctly detected under the COM: section.

Step 4: Enter the Original IMEI Numbers Locate the IMEI input fields in the tool. IMEI1 - Input your device's first original IMEI number. IMEI2 - Input the second original IMEI number (if it is a Dual-SIM device). Double-check the numbers for accuracy, then click on the Start button.

Step 5: Process Completion & Reboot The tool will write the hardware identifiers to your device within a few seconds and display a Success or Pass status. Disconnect your phone from the PC and Restart (Reboot) the device. 

Verification

Once your phone boots up, open the dialer app and type *#06#. Your original IMEI numbers should now be visible on the screen, and network signals should return to normal.

⚠️ Disclaimer: This guide is intended strictly for restoring a device's Original IMEI (the one assigned by the manufacturer). Changing a device's IMEI to a different one is illegal in many countries. Use this tool responsibly and entirely at your own risk.
